AM335x的模数转换子系统在一种终端控制器中的应用

         

摘要

实现了一种应用于地下水行业的测控终端控制器的触摸屏及模拟量采集方案.阐述了德州仪器Sitara AM335 x微处理器的触摸屏控制器与模数转换子系统的结构和工作流程.采用软件方式同步转换步骤,遵从平台依赖驱动结构实现了四线制电阻触摸屏驱动程序,有效解决了触摸动作误判和触点跳动的问题;遵从流驱动结构实现了模拟量采集驱动程序,能够采集来自于水位计、流量计、压力计的标准4~20 mA电流信号.该方案结构紧凑,稳定性、可靠性强,适合基于AM335 x和 WinCE7.0嵌入式平台的控制器设计.%A touch screen and analog signal acquisition scheme for the measurement and control terminal controller used in underground water industry was implemented.The structure and working process of the touch screen controller and analog-digital converter subsystem of TI Sitara AM335X microprocessor was introduced.By both adopting software-ena bled mode to start each conversion step,a four-wire resistive touch screen driver according to the platform dependent driver structure and an analog acquisition driver according to the flow driven structure were implemented.The former can solve the problem of the touch action misjudgment and the contact bounce effectively and the latter has the ability to collect standard 4-20 mA current signal from water level meter,flow meter and pressure gauge.With the advantages of compact structure,high sta bility and high reliability,the scheme is very suita ble for the controller design based on AM335X and WinCE7.0 platform.
